Benefits and Installation Guide for Charlotte NC Indoor Spray Foam Insulation

As a resident of Charlotte, NC, you’re likely no stranger to the sweltering summer heat and chilly winter nights. While traditional insulation methods can help keep your home comfortable, spray foam insulation offers a more effective and efficient solution for indoor climates. In this article, we’ll explore the benefits and installation process of indoor spray foam insulation in Charlotte, NC.

What is Indoor Spray Foam Insulation?

Indoor spray foam insulation is a type of insulation material made from two primary components: isocyanate and polyol. When mixed together, these chemicals react to form a rigid, foam-like substance that can be sprayed directly onto interior surfaces. This versatile material can be applied to walls, ceilings, floors, and even pipes to provide a continuous layer of insulation.

Benefits of Indoor Spray Foam Insulation

1. Energy Efficiency: Spray foam insulation offers unparalleled thermal resistance, reducing heat transfer and minimizing energy losses. This results in significant cost savings on your energy bills, especially in regions with extreme temperature fluctuations like Charlotte, NC.

2. Moisture Barrier: The open-cell structure of spray foam insulation allows it to breathe, reducing the risk of moisture accumulation and related issues like mold growth, mildew, and condensation.

3. Pest and Rodent Control: The dense, foam-like material is unappealing to pests and rodents, reducing the likelihood of infestations and related damage to your home’s structural integrity.

4. Sound Reduction: Spray foam insulation can effectively reduce sound transmission, creating a quieter living environment and minimizing sound leakage between rooms and outside noise.

5. Allergy-Friendly: The dense, non-absorbent nature of spray foam insulation reduces the accumulation of dust, dander, and other allergens, making it an ideal choice for homeowners with allergy concerns.

6. Fire Resistance: Most spray foam insulation products have a Class I fire rating, which means they’re resistant to both vertical and horizontal flame spread.

7. Versatility: Indoor spray foam insulation can be applied to a wide range of surfaces, including drywall, wood, concrete, and even metal, making it an excellent choice for homes with unique architectural features.

Installation Process for Indoor Spray Foam Insulation in Charlotte, NC

While DIY kits are available for small-scale applications, it’s recommended to hire a professional for larger installations, as the process requires specialized equipment and safety measures. Here’s a step-by-step guide to the installation process:

Step 1: Prepare the Surface

Before applying spray foam insulation, ensure the surface is clean, dry, and free of debris. Remove any existing insulation, drywall, or other materials to create a smooth surface.

Step 2: Tape Off Edges

Use specialized tape or masking film to cover edges, baseboards, and any areas you don’t want insulation to adhere to.

Step 3: Mix and Apply the Insulation

Using a spray gun or caulking tool, mix the isocyanate and polyol components according to the manufacturer’s instructions. Spray the mixture onto the prepared surface in a controlled, even pattern. Apply multiple layers, allowing each layer to dry and cure according to the manufacturer’s specifications.

Step 4: Finish and Clean Up

Once the final layer is applied and cured, remove any excess foam with a utility knife or razor blade. Clean up any spills or residue with a solvent-based cleaner and rag.

Step 5: Inspect and Touch-Up

Inspect the installation for any gaps, cracks, or areas that require additional coverage. Apply additional coats as needed to achieve the desired level of insulation.

Things to Consider Before Installing Indoor Spray Foam Insulation in Charlotte, NC

1. Budget: Determine your budget for the installation, as costs can vary depending on the size of your home, surface area to be insulated, and labor costs.

2. Space Constraints: Consider the confined spaces or unique architectural features in your home that may require specialized installation techniques.

3. Environmental Concerns: Charlotte, NC, has a humid subtropical climate with high humidity levels. Make sure to choose an insulation material that’s resistant to moisture and humidity.

4. Maintenance: Spray foam insulation requires minimal maintenance, but it’s essential to conduct regular inspections to identify any damage or wear and tear.
